摘要

The TA15 powder ingots were successfully fabricated by powder hot isostatic pressing. The influence of heat treatment on the microstructural homogeneous and tensile properties has been investigated. The optimum heat treatment route was solution and aging treatment, i.e., 930 degrees C/2h/WQ + 600 degrees C/4h/AC, it attributed to improving the microstructure homogeneity. With the secondary alpha s phase precipitated within the beta matrix, the tensile strength was also improved. Furthermore, the fracture mechanisms for the different microstructures were discussed in detail.
